Bibliography

Reported in ARIE 1903-1904 (ARIE/1898-1899/B/1899/11).

Edited in Subrahmanya Aiyer 1928 (SII 6.447). Text and summary in Mahalingam 1988 (IP 125).

This revised edition by Emmanuel Francis, based on autopsy and photos.

Primary

[SII] Subrahmanya Aiyer, K. V. 1928. South-Indian inscriptions (texts). Volume VI: Miscellaneous inscriptions from the Tamil, Telugu and Kannada countries. South Indian Inscriptions 6. Calcutta: Government of India, Central Publication Branch. Page 185, item 447.

[IP] Mahalingam, T. V. 1988. Inscriptions of the Pallavas. New Delhi; Delhi: Indian Council of Historical Research; Agam Prakashan. Pages 386–387, item 125.
